Welcome G, Sorry I didn't answer until now, rough day yesterday. Which do you want to do? Usually we detoxed cold turkey but that was in a medical setting.If you go ct you can expect about a week of wd like a bad case of the flu.Robert Cheeky and Azul know more about tapers than I do . If you taper I would drop two pills every other day. Ct use the Thomas recipe,protein shakes. Robert and Cheeky will be back on I'm sure and correct any misinformation I have given you. Attitude plays a big role here glad to hear you want to get off. Tou will find that once off the opiates the pain is not nearly as severe as you thought. The opiates really mess withe nuerotransmitters and it takes a while for the brain to heal. AA?NA meetings are a big plus that is your support system and you con't have to say you are an addict. Ct is the only way I did it, rough for about 3-4 days then gets better. Exercise as much as you can even if it just short walks, hot showers or baths.
Check with the others prior to using what I have said . God Bless and Good luck Surfdog -
